  • Patent number: 5231836
    Abstract: First and second indirect contact condensing heat exchangers are used to separate gases from a mixture of condensible and non-condensible gases, such as the vapor from the last stage of a black liquor evaporation plant of a pulp mill. The mixture of gases passes over the first heat exchanger to cool and condense, producing a first condensate and a first remaining gas stream. The condensate is removed from the first remaining gas stream, the gas stream then being passed over the second heat exchanger. A medium for absorbing at least one non-condensible gas in the first gas stream--such as an NaOH liquid solutino--is passed over the surface of the second heat exchanger to absorb gas, and produce a second remaining gas stream (containing primarily air). The second gas stream is separated from the solution with absorbed gas. The solution with absorbed gas may be used as white liquor in kraft pulping in a pulp mill, without concentrating the solution.

  • Patent number: 4348261
    Abstract: A continuous method and apparatus for distilling a liquid include conducting the distilling liquid through at least two successive distillation units operating at different temperature levels. The distilling liquid is vaporized in each distillation unit and the obtained vapor condensed into distillate by conducting the vapor into heat exchange relationship with the liquid discharged from the evaporators in a succeeding distillation unit which operates at a lower temperature level. At least one of the distillation units includes a plurality of communicating distillation stages, each distillation stage including an evaporator and a corresponding condenser.

  • Patent number: 4105505
    Abstract: A flash evaporator to be used for purposes such as distilling sea water has a series of evaporator stages in which vapor derived from liquid flowing through the successive evaporator stages is condensed to form a distillate. A wall structure situated in each evaporated stage defines therein an elongated narrow gap the length of which is substantially greater than the width of each evaporator stage with this gap forming an orifice through which the liquid is compelled to issue while flowing from an inlet to an outlet of each evaporator stage. Between the inlet and the gap in each evaporator stage the wall structure defines an upstream flow path the cross section of which decreases from the inlet toward the gap. From the gap toward the outlet of each stage the wall structure defines a downstream flow path the cross section of which increases from the gap toward the outlet.

  • Patent number: 4002440
    Abstract: A method and apparatus for operating on liquids and gases to perform operations such as altering the extent to which a gas is contained in a liquid and pumping a gas, by means of a liquid, from a lower pressure to a higher pressure. A liquid is drawn upwardly along a suction tube from a first body of the liquid to an elevation substantially higher than this first body so as to reduce the hydrostatic head of the liquid, and from the suction tube the liquid flows back down a delivery tube to a second body of the liquid, an ejector being provided at the upper end region of the delivery tube for increasing the velocity of flow of the liquid while further reducing the pressure thereof. At the ejector a gas is combined with the liquid to be pumped thereby from a lower to a higher pressure, or a gas at a relatively higher pressure than the liquid at the ejector is combined with this liquid at the ejector to be at least partly dissolved into the liquid.
